    Hi, I recently downloaded d20 Pro. I'm trying to download the trial license, but whenever I click download I get the following message:

    Unable to download license.
    Caused by: licenses/license_Victor R.(d20Pro_Trial_2.0.0).txt (Read-only file system).

    I ran a search on my computer for a file of that description, but can't find it. Any advice? Could it be because I accidentally downloaded an earlier version first, then deleted it and installed the current one?

    Issue: "(Read-only file system)"

    Detailed response @ read this post

    Summary Solution:
    If running Windows7 >> make sure to run as administrator

    If running MacOS >> make sure to drag the d20Pro application out of the .dmg file before running it.
